RCF Audio has released new firmware (ver. 170) and apps (both for iOS and Android) for the M 20X digital mixer. The update offers, amongst bug fixes and system improvements: Improved system robustness and stability Extended digital trim level to -30…+30 dB for Stream / SD card / Drive input sources New “Solo Clear” function New Main Out After Fader Level (AFL) source option for Outputs Routing Fix of initial EQ settings after a Factory Reset Download the firmware update here.

Det Nye Teateret (The New Theatre) is a brand new theatre in Trondheim, Norway that has fully embraced livestreamed performances, with a little help from Norsk Pro and a dLive mixing system. Det Nye Teateret had not yet hosted its first performance when the COVID-19 pandemic changed the landscape, forcing a complete rethink. Rather than choosing to film conventional performances onstage, the theatre has devised a series of dynamic performances through 2020 involving labyrinthine sets and performers ranging throughout the 1000m2 space.
